Moving Average
Also known as: Exponential Moving Average (EMA), EMA, SMA, Simple Moving Average, Simple Moving Average (SMA), Exponential Moving Average, Moving Averages, Medias Móviles, MA, Hull Moving Average, HMA, WMA, Moving Average (MA)
Moving averages smooth price into a single trend line and remain the backbone of systematic trading — as trend filters, dynamic support/resistance, and crossover signals. Variants include the simple (SMA), exponential (EMA), weighted (WMA) and Hull (HMA) moving averages.

Frequently asked questions
What is the primary purpose of a Moving Average in trading?
A Moving Average serves to simplify complex price action by creating a constantly updated average price. Its main goal is to identify the direction of a trend and determine potential areas of support and resistance. By removing the 'noise' of short-term volatility, it allows traders to see the broader market consensus. It helps in distinguishing between a temporary price spike and a sustained directional shift, making it an essential tool for trend-following strategies and risk management.
How do Simple and Exponential Moving Averages differ?
The difference lies in how they weight data. A Simple Moving Average (SMA) treats all price points in the period equally, resulting in a smoother but slower-reacting line. In contrast, an Exponential Moving Average (EMA) prioritizes the most recent price action, making it react faster to current market changes. Short-term traders often prefer EMAs to capture quick moves, while long-term investors may use SMAs to filter out minor fluctuations and focus on the primary cycle of an asset.
When is the best time to use a Moving Average indicator?
Moving Averages perform best in trending markets where prices are clearly advancing or declining. They are particularly useful for confirming trend reversals via 'crossovers'—such as the Golden Cross or Death Cross—where a short-term average crosses a long-term one. However, they are less reliable in range-bound or consolidating markets, as the lack of momentum causes the price to frequently intersect the average, generating 'whipsaw' signals that can lead to frequent small losses if used in isolation.
